Hope For Tomorrow
Wandering merchant of valuable circumstance,
Pass by again when hearts are accepting
If knowledge is power
Your strength is unmatched
And all would profit from your altering words
Wandering shepherd of flocks torn and tattered,
Remember this place as holder of tomorrow's hope
If death rewards life
With eternal slumber
Then all firmly stand near shallow-dug graves
Wandering prophet of light shining brightly,
Give direction to causes tired and true
If nothing is gained
Then lose would be forgotten
Clearing the minds of secrets that consume
Sweet twilight
Rhythmically swaying in surreal lullabies
Guide these brave wanderers
For the sake of unmistakable bliss
